Rotherham United have appointed Nicky Eaden as their assistant manager on a two-and-a-half-year deal,
The 43-year-old replaces Eric Black who left for Premier League strugglers Aston Villa last week.
Eaden, who has recently been working with Leicester City's under-21s, played with Millers head coach Neil Redfearn at Barnsley.
"He is good at working with and developing players and that was key to bringing him here," Redfearn said.
